Ernest Clark
Ernest Clark (born February 12 1912 in London, England - died November 11 1994 in Somerset, England) was a British actor who was an accomplished actor of stage, television and film. He appeared in plays at both the West End in London, and Broadway in New York.

He is perhaps best known for his role as Professor Geoffrey Loftus in the television comedy series "Doctor in the House", except for the sequel "Doctor at Sea", where he appeared as "Captain Norman Loftus" (the brother of "Professor Loftus").
